Make sure it goes into Studio/Content/Runtime after its been unzipped!

That is a great first render! And your system must be better then mine with handling two people and all those other things! it is a good scene, it works you can tell what is going on.

I would suggest two other places for more freebies in general 1. RDNA or Runtime DNA and 2. Renderosity they both have freebie sections, although Renderosity is user submitted so you really have to be careful and unzip them to your desktop or somewhere first and make sure the folders are arranged right.

Just some suggestions for later, I don't know why your render is pixiley so I'll pass that. But you have a white background area showing through the grate, I'd postwork that out, or put something behind it (like a copy of the top wall or something). Also, you can use the spandex settings to make things like but cheeks less prominant and make it look more like a suit they are wearing. There should also be a texture for the frog with that freebie, but I didn't learn about freebie/folder organization until I had been using DAZ a while so at this point I'm up to three installs and wipes to reorganize, so I bet you just missed it. Daz Studio is what I use for my characters...sometimes in tandem with Bryce, but I don't use poser..the hair works fine in Daz...I'm not sure what you're doing and how you're set up... There are threads at the daz forums that address various issues like hair problems... I know it works though. Did you make sure to install it into the correct folders? I have a shortcut to the daz studio program folder on my desktop, because I don't trust installations that aren't the official daz one to put themselves where they belong. So I open up my daz studio/content/ folder and copy/paste the runtime folder of each new download into it...It says there is already a runtime folder, yes you want to overwrite it...it just adds the new stuff... Other than that, I am not sure of what issues you're having. (I unzip the download into a temporary folder I've made for that and manually cut and paste the runtime folder into the daz studio content as I described. Also I can then paste readmes into the readme folder I want them in as well)
